我用得是sql2000 数据库,现在需要将数据从本机上传到服务器,但是由于数据库有一些老数据,传得特别慢,如何办呢?

解决方案 »

  1.   

    在DotNet环境上,使用SqlBulkCopy是最快的方法"Microsoft SQL Server 提供一个称为 bcp 的流行的命令提示符实用工具,用于将数据从一个表移动到另一个表(表既可以在同一个服务器上,也可以在不同服务器上)。SqlBulkCopy 类允许编写提供类似功能的托管代码解决方案。还有其他将数据加载到 SQL Server 表的方法(例如 INSERT 语句),但相比之下 SqlBulkCopy 提供明显的性能优势。"-------以上引自MSDN